Steroid delivery systems for contraception

B B Pharriss, V A Place, L Sendelbeck

    The Journal of Reproductive Medicine
    |August 1, 1976
    PubMed
    Summary

    New contraceptive methods utilize bioerodible polymers for predictable steroid release, enhancing hormonal contraception delivery via implants and uterine systems for effective fertility control.

    Area of Science:

    • Biomaterials science and reproductive endocrinology.
    • Interdisciplinary approaches in pharmaceutical development.

    Background:

    • Steroidal contraception development faced challenges with predictable drug delivery.
    • Existing methods lacked optimal localization and systemic administration control.

    Purpose of the Study:

    • To enhance steroidal contraception effectiveness and attractiveness.
    • To develop novel delivery systems for hormonal contraceptives.

    Main Methods:

    • Utilizing bioerodible polymeric carriers for systemic administration.
    • Developing polymeric progesterone delivery systems for uterine localization.

    Main Results:

    • Overcame hurdles in developing subcutaneous contraceptive implants.
    • Enabled localized hormonal contraception within the uterine cavity.

    Conclusions:

    • Polymeric delivery systems offer significant advancements in contraceptive technology.
    • These innovations provide valuable tools for fertility management.
